Whoa! I dove back into the weeds on DEX aggregators this week. My instinct said there was somethin’ off with the headline volumes. At first everything screamed “liquidity” and “healthy trading,” though actually when you slice timeframes the story splits and fragments in ways that matter. Here’s the thing.
Seriously? You bet. I watched a handful of trades route through three different aggregators and the realized slippage on one of them was far worse than the quoted price suggested. Initially I thought the aggregator quote was the culprit, but then realized the pool composition and temporary imbalance were the real issue—and that matters more to traders than the headline number. On one hand the aggregator added value by finding a path; on the other hand the pooling design amplified price impact in thin markets, which is sneaky. Okay, so check this out—
Trader intuition helps. Hmm… you can feel when an order will slip just from orderbook behavior and pool token ratios, even before you run the math. System 2 kicks in when you start modeling expected slippage vs. execution probability and time-of-day flow. Actually, wait—let me rephrase that: the math tells you the expected slippage, but real-time flow decides whether that expectation turns into reality. Sometimes the model is fine, but the environment isn’t—very very important nuance.
Here’s a quick anatomy lesson for those juggling DEXs and aggregators. A DEX aggregator takes fragments of liquidity across many pools and routes your swap through them to get a better price than any single pool could offer alone. Short swaps might piggyback on deep pools, while larger tickets get sliced across several pairs or chains to limit price impact. But aggregators rely on accurate, real-time liquidity snapshots—and those snapshots can be stale, mispriced, or gamed during volatile periods. That echo effect is subtle and it’s what bugs me about many dashboard metrics.
Check this out—

That image captures the moment you realize a quoted route is illusory. My first impression was “nice routing,” but then the trade failed to match the expected path. I’m biased, but I’ve seen this pattern across both new and established chains; on some chains liquidity can evaporate faster than you think. (oh, and by the way…) slippage tolerance settings are your friend—but only if you know the pool’s depth, token volatility, and sandwich attack risk.
Why trading volume numbers lie — and what to trust instead
Volume is noisy. Really noisy. Reported volume often bundles wash trading, circular swaps, and rapid bot churn that inflate weekly totals without delivering true economic activity. Initially I assumed high volume equalled strong demand, but then realized that on-chain appearance and economic reality diverge frequently. So what should you trust? Look at realized liquidity—how much depth exists within acceptable slippage for your ticket size—rather than headline dollar volume alone. My gut says to check both aggregated historical depth and instantaneous pool ratios before you send a large order.
Liquidity pools can be deceptive too. A pool with $10M TVL doesn’t mean you can swap $500k without serious impact. Pool composition matters: stable-stable pools behave differently than token-token pools with asymmetric exposure to impermanent loss. On some pools the LPs are heavily concentrated from a few wallets; that centralization risk raises the chance of sudden withdrawals. I’m not 100% sure on all edge cases, but the pattern repeats enough to be worrying—especially during cross-chain storms.
Aggregation mechanics vary by provider. Some aggregators prioritize pure price across routes, others consider execution certainty, front-run protection, or fee rebates. Initially I favored the lowest quoted price, but then learned that quoted price ignores the probability of execution and MEV extraction between quote and fill. Actually, wait—let me rephrase that: the best route on paper can be the worst in practice when MEV bots or latency differences intervene. So you need both a good quote and a reliable execution layer.
Route transparency helps. Wow! If the aggregator gives you a break-down of each hop, pool depth, and expected slippage, you can make smarter choices. Some interfaces are clearer than others; the ones that expose token ratios, fee tiers, and historical price impact make my life easier. I’m telling you—there’s value in seeing the plumbing. Also, check the aggregator’s incentives: are they routing to liquidity that pays them kickbacks? That hidden fee changes the game.
Practical checklist for traders (real stuff you can use)
Ready? Good. First: always compute expected price impact for your trade size using the pool’s current balances and fee structure. Second: split larger orders across time or routes if the expected impact is too high. Third: inspect the LP concentration—big holders can drain pools fast. Fourth: low native token liquidity (on the chain) can add bridging risk when your route crosses chains. Fifth: use slippage tolerance conservatively, but not so tight that you simply fail executions repeatedly.
I’ll be honest—tools help. The dexscreener official site gives quick snapshots that are useful for triaging opportunities, though you still need to validate depth and recent flow. Try to correlate what the aggregator shows with block-level trade data, or simulate the swap against the pool state before broadcasting. Simulation is cheap and effective; use it to avoid surprises. Sometimes a simple dry-run saves you 0.5% to 2% of capital—worth it on big trades.
On one hand automation reduces manual fatigue; on the other hand over-reliance on a single dashboard creates blind spots. I’ve automated execution logic before and had it fail when pools rebalanced unexpectedly in response to an oracle update. The fix? Add fallback logic and watch for oracle slippage. Also set up alerts for unusual LP withdrawals—those are early warning signals that a pool might go thin very fast.
Common trader questions
Q: How does an aggregator find the best route?
A: It runs a combinatorial search across pools and bridges, optimizing for price, fees, and sometimes execution certainty; but the best theoretical route can be undermined by latency, MEV, or sudden pool rebalances.
Q: Is reported volume reliable?
A: Not always. Look beyond raw volume—check trade frequency, size distribution, and the ratio of unique addresses to trades to estimate genuine activity versus wash trading.
Q: How much slippage tolerance should I set?
A: It depends on ticket size and pool depth. For small retail trades 0.5% to 1% might be fine; for larger institutional-sized trades, simulate first and consider splitting the order to keep slippage within acceptable bounds.
To wrap up—well, not a neat wrap-up because that feels fake—my main point is this: metrics without context are dangerous. Traders need both the high-level dashboards and the plumbing view. Something felt off the first few times I traced routes in volatile markets, and that gut feeling saved me from bad fills more than once. Keep your tools, but double-check the plumbing. Somethin’ tells me that’s the only reliable way to trade DeFi at scale… and yeah, there’s still more to learn.






